随着餐饮行业数字化转型的不断深入,越来越多商家开始意识到自建外卖系统的重要性。传统的第三方平台虽然便捷,但高昂的佣金、数据不透明以及功能受限等问题,逐渐成为中小餐饮企业发展的瓶颈。在此背景下,外卖源码开发应运而生,成为众多企业实现自主运营、提升用户体验的关键路径。然而,面对复杂的业务逻辑、多端兼容性要求以及不断变化的市场需求,如何高效完成一套稳定、可扩展的外卖系统开发,已成为开发者与客户共同关注的核心议题。尤其是在跨地域团队协作日益普遍的今天,单纯依靠个人能力已难以应对项目复杂度的提升,必须引入系统化的协同技术与科学的开发思路,才能真正实现高质量交付。
协同技术:打破开发壁垒的关键引擎
在现代软件开发中,协同技术早已不是“锦上添花”的选项,而是项目成功的基础保障。对于外卖源码开发而言,高效的团队协作直接决定了项目的进度与质量。版本控制工具如Git,是协作开发的基石。通过合理的分支管理策略(如Git Flow),团队成员可以在不影响主干代码的前提下并行开发新功能,减少冲突风险。同时,结合GitHub、Gitee等平台的PR(Pull Request)机制,代码审查流程得以规范化,有效降低了因人为疏忽导致的漏洞问题。此外,任务分配系统如Jira、Trello或飞书项目,能够将整体开发目标拆解为可追踪的小任务,明确责任人与截止时间,避免“谁都不清楚该做什么”的混乱局面。
实时沟通工具的集成同样不可忽视。微信、钉钉、Slack等平台虽非专为开发设计,但其即时消息、文件共享和语音会议功能,在日常沟通中起到了不可或缺的作用。尤其当团队成员分布在不同城市甚至国家时,一个稳定的沟通渠道能极大缩短信息传递延迟。更重要的是,将这些工具与开发流程深度整合,例如通过机器人自动通知任务更新、构建状态提醒,可以形成“开发-沟通-反馈”闭环,显著提升响应效率。

清晰的开发思路:从需求到落地的系统化路径
再先进的技术也无法弥补思路混乱带来的损失。一套成功的外卖源码开发,必须建立在清晰的开发框架之上。首先,需求分析阶段需深入调研客户实际场景,不仅要了解“要什么功能”,更要理解“为什么需要”。例如,某些商家更关注订单处理速度,而另一些则重视营销工具的丰富性。只有精准定位核心痛点,才能避免功能冗余或关键缺失。
接下来是模块拆解。一个完整的外卖系统通常包括用户端、商户端、配送端、后台管理端四大模块,每个模块又可进一步细分为登录认证、商品管理、订单流程、支付对接、评价系统等子功能。通过结构化拆分,不仅便于分工合作,也为后续的测试与维护提供了便利。在此基础上,制定合理的迭代规划至关重要。采用敏捷开发模式,将整个项目划分为若干个2~4周的迭代周期,每轮聚焦特定功能的实现与验证,既能快速响应需求变更,又能及时暴露潜在问题,避免后期大规模返工。
收费透明化:信任与长期合作的基石
许多客户在选择外卖源码开发服务时,最担心的问题之一就是“价格不透明”或“隐形增项”。因此,合理的收费标准设计不仅是商业考量,更是赢得客户信任的关键。我们主张采用分阶段付款机制:前期签订合同后支付30%预付款,完成核心模块开发并通过初步验收后支付40%,最终上线并稳定运行一个月后再支付剩余30%。这种模式既保障了开发方的资金流,也让客户对项目进展有更强掌控感。
同时,所有费用明细应在合同中清晰列明,包括功能点对应的价格、额外定制的计费标准、后期维护的服务范围等。杜绝“口头承诺”和“模糊报价”,真正做到“明码标价、按需付费”。这样的做法不仅能减少纠纷,还能帮助客户建立理性预算意识,从而推动整个行业向更加规范的方向发展。
应对挑战:敏捷开发与阶段性评审双管齐下
在实际开发过程中,进度延迟与需求频繁变更几乎是常态。对此,我们建议采用“敏捷开发+阶段性评审”双机制。每个迭代周期结束后,组织一次正式的评审会议,邀请客户代表参与,演示当前版本的功能成果,收集反馈意见。若发现需求偏差,可在下一阶段灵活调整,而不必等到项目尾声才进行大改。这种方式既尊重客户意愿,也有效控制了项目风险。
此外,建立完善的文档体系同样重要。从接口说明、数据库设计到部署手册,每一份文档都应保持最新状态。这不仅方便内部交接,也为后期系统的升级与报修提供依据。尤其在客户自行运维的情况下,详尽的文档能大幅降低技术门槛。
综上所述,外卖源码开发已不再是简单的代码堆砌,而是一项融合技术、管理与商业思维的综合性工程。通过引入协同技术、构建清晰开发思路、实施透明收费机制,并辅以敏捷开发与阶段性评审,完全有可能实现开发周期缩短30%以上,客户满意度突破90%的目标。未来,随着更多企业意识到自主系统的价值,这一领域将迎来更深层次的变革。我们始终致力于为客户提供高性价比、可持续演进的解决方案,助力每一个餐饮品牌实现数字化跃迁。
17723342546
